Great Idea!mikehalloran wrote:For wires that are spaced apart under a flat surface, you can get long strips of Velcro. I don't trust the double-stick tape so I use a staple gun to attach one half under a desk. Lay your cables across and use the other side to hold them in place.

It is a great idea. I've always created a "sling" with 2 sided Velcro, screwing in one end with a short machine screw and wrapping it tightly around the bunch of cables of similar type and sticking it to itself. Not as neat, however.
